**Onboarding: Waveform Preview Hooks**

Welcome to the Soundreef plugin program. Your plugin renders into the waveform preview pane via the `previewSlice` callback; always downsample to 2,048 points before drawing, or the host will throttle you. To unlock the signed sandbox for local testing, you'll need the developer recovery passphrase issued at onboarding, which is recorded directly below for convenience.

strongbox words: norwyn-wenael-aldvan-aldiel-wendor-holael

Subject: Key rotation — reminder job

Heads up: the credential for the Bellroot clinic appointment reminder job rotates tonight at 22:00. Old key dies at 22:15; no overlap beyond that. Update the scheduler secret before the 21:45 freeze or tomorrow's SMS batch fails silently. No other services affected. The replacement key for the Notifier service is below.

service key, tadup-tahog: zpat7_wB1tnEL

## Authentication

Heads up: the nightly reindex job (`reindex_nightly.py`) talks to the Lanternfish search cluster, and that cluster won't accept anonymous writes anymore — we locked it down last sprint. The job now authenticates as the `reindex-runner` service identity against Corvid Gateway, and the token is injected via the `LF_INDEX_TOKEN` env var in the scheduler config. Nothing clever going on, just a bearer header on every batch request. For review purposes, the staging credential currently in use is listed below.

service key, kadug-kadup: kto15_rN23XLAYImmZgrJ

Handover — Alert Dedup (Chimekeeper)

Hey, welcome aboard! You're inheriting Chimekeeper, our on-call alert deduplicator. It clusters alerts by fingerprint and suppresses repeats within a 10-minute window. Known quirk: the Redis cache occasionally drops fingerprints after a failover, so you'll see duplicate pages on Mondays — there's a ticket for it. Staging config lives in the ops repo under /chimekeeper. If the admin console locks you out, recover access with the passphrase below.

unlock words, yawig-kagef: gordor-holvan-ulaael-pramir-ulaiel-tamdor